History & Origin
Bayron is a Spanish-influenced spelling of Byron, from Old English byre (cattle shed) + tun (settlement).
Bayron has appeared in US birth records, particularly in Latino communities.
Did you know? Lord Byron (1788–1824) was described as 'mad, bad, and dangerous to know' — making Byron/Bayron a name synonymous with Romantic defiance, poetic genius, and scandalous charm.
